Size & Zoning Rules
Converting your garage to a legal rental unit means the finished space must comply with Hayward's ADU size limits. Hayward's current ADU size cap is 1,200 sq ft — generous enough to accommodate most project types.
Hayward does not impose an owner-occupancy requirement, so you can rent both the main home and any ADU or conversion as investment units.

Permit Process & Fees
Development Services Department permit fees for this project type typically range from $12,505 to $21,933 depending on project valuation and scope. Plan check runs approximately 7 weeks — though each correction cycle adds 3–6 weeks, which is why code-compliant drawings matter so much.
Garage conversion drawings submitted to Development Services Department must include a site plan, floor plans, all four elevations, an electrical plan, and energy compliance documentation — plus stamped structural plans are typically required for converted garages that are detached or require seismic upgrades.

⚠ Common Pitfall in Hayward
Hayward's Development Services Department routes most ADU plans through a mandatory Fire Prevention review because so much of the city sits in a moderate-to-high fire hazard area near the hills, and that review runs separately from the standard plan check — adding real time if your drawings don't already show ignition-resistant materials and proper clearances. Because the city sits in Seismic Design Category D, older Hayward homes (many built pre-1980 near the Hayward Fault) often trigger a structural review of the existing foundation when you attach or convert a garage, which can mean an engineer visit and change orders you didn't budget for. Also, Hayward's sewer lateral ordinance requires a lateral inspection — and sometimes replacement — before final signoff, which catches a lot of homeowners off guard mid-project.

Can I convert my garage into a rental unit in Hayward? +
Yes — a permitted garage conversion can function as a standalone rental unit (ADU or JADU depending on size). In California, converted garages under 500 sq ft qualify as Junior ADUs (JADUs), while larger conversions qualify as full ADUs. Both can be rented long-term. Short-term rental rules vary by city — confirm with Hayward's planning department.
Do I need to replace the garage door opening when converting? +
Yes. The garage door must be replaced with an insulated wall with a standard entry door and at least one egress window (minimum 5.7 sq ft clear opening). This is captured in our elevation drawings and flagged in the electrical plan. The new wall must also meet CA energy code requirements, which we handle in the Title 24 compliance documentation.
